Named after the Alhambra Palace built in 14th Century southern Spain, this European-style café is decorated with ornate furniture and fancy gold-encrusted objects — a nice getaway without hopping on a plane.
And an added bonus: This café is independently owned, something that's becoming somewhat of an anomaly as Starbucks takes one too many street corners.
Adding to the charming interior, the outdoor patio welcomes cafe-hopping visitors with a plethora of tables right next to a grass-filled outdoor area. Yep, it's hard to say no to outdoor eating. Inside, patrons can enjoy a nice view of the gold-encrusted Rancilio espresso machine, handsome wooden tables and patterned fabric-covered chairs all in a periwinkle blue room.
Violins are propped up on the wall and wood floors provide a nice complement to the handsome interior space. Expect occasional live music and a computer-free environment. BYO - $10 corkage fee.
